The reason why flat UI design is trending (apparently nobody here has done graphic design) is that with mobile devices having a variety of screen resolutions and websites being cross-platform, it is essentially easier to rescale assets and still have then be aesthetically pleasing without taking up space. Skeuomorphic design sadly can't keep up with that.
